Wonderfully decadent craft ice cream. The 16% butterfat makes this ultra-premium ice cream have a thick and silky mouth feel. I love the sample size they serve. The sample is a full scoop of ice cream or sorbet, not the little tasting spoon you would receive from main stream ice cream shops. The tour was fun and informative. As for the other reviews of the Bourbon Burnt Sugar, well I bought a pint and I have to say that the pint I bought was very on point. The bourbon flavor was there, but you had to let the ice cream warm up a bit. Due to the way we taste flavors, if the food is cold the flavors will be muted. If you allow the food to warm a bit or in the case of this ice cream, allow it to melt a bit in the mouth then the bourbon and caramel flavors of the burnt sugar will be brought forward. If the flavors are so strong as to be tasted right up front then, more than likely they will be way over powering upon warming up.

The Saturday tour is awesome. Get samples of their newest flavors here. These people are passionate about their work, and it shows in their products. I can't wait to go again next weekend. Edit- As of March 20, 2015, they have changed their tours from Saturday morning to Friday afternoon 4 pm until 9 pm. If they have what you want in the sampling tray, but not in the freezer, they will hand pack a pint for you. Great customer service, and great people. Edit- As of Thursday, April 2, 2015 the factory tastings have been canceled. This is from their Facebook website. "It's time for us to closing our factory store for good, effective immediately. We need to seal our doors to comply with food safety standards and qualifications that will help us grow. (Thank you—we wouldn't have been able to grow without your support!) This doesn't mean we're turning into hermits: You'll see us around at store demos and special events, which we'll post. We hope you'll find us and say hello!"
